A move in a Cary July is not the same job as one in October. Humidity changes what boxes hold up, what furniture needs extra care, and how a closed truck behaves.

Packing for a Humid Triangle Summer

Why standard boxes fail here

Thin cardboard softens in humid air faster than most people expect, especially if boxes sit stacked in a garage or a trailer for even a few hours. A double-walled box holds its shape through a full moving day where a thinner one starts to sag.

If you are packing yourself, buy sturdier boxes for the bottom of any stack and put the lighter items on top, since a soft box at the bottom of a stack is how a whole tower collapses.

Wood furniture and humidity

Solid wood dressers and tables can swell slightly in humid air and then shrink again once they are back in an air-conditioned house, which is why drawers sometimes stick for a week or two after a summer move.

Wrapping wood furniture in moving blankets rather than plastic film for the drive helps, since plastic can trap moisture against the surface on a hot day.

Electronics and anything with a battery

A closed trailer parked in the sun runs hotter inside than the air outside it, sometimes by a significant margin. Electronics, especially anything with a lithium battery, should load last and come off first so they spend the least time in that heat.

Photograph the back of televisions and computer setups before disconnecting cables, then bag and label the cords so reconnecting at the new place is quick rather than a guessing game.

What to just carry yourself

Candles, cosmetics, vinyl records, and houseplants are the items most likely to suffer in a hot trailer, and the easiest fix is simply to carry them in your own air-conditioned car rather than loading them on the truck.

It is a small adjustment that avoids a genuinely disappointing surprise when the truck is unloaded at the other end.

Timing a move around the forecast

A humid afternoon thunderstorm is a near-daily event in the Triangle through midsummer, so we schedule the heaviest outdoor carries for the morning where the calendar allows it.

If rain does roll through mid-move, we cover open truck doors and pause loading rather than rushing furniture through a downpour, and we build a little slack into the day's schedule for exactly that.
